Sunshine Glory Hosta
Hosta 'Sunshine Glory'
Luminous and lush, Sunshine Glory Hosta brings a bright, cheerful presence to shaded garden spaces. This striking variety features large, heart-shaped leaves with glowing golden-yellow centers surrounded by wide, chartreuse to soft green margins. As the season progresses, the foliage intensifies in color, adding dynamic texture and vibrant contrast to shade borders and woodland gardens.
In mid to late summer, tall stalks emerge bearing pale lavender, bell-shaped flowers that attract bees and hummingbirds. With its substantial size and brilliant coloring, ‘Sunshine Glory’ makes an excellent focal point in hosta collections or mixed shade plantings.
Thriving in partial to full shade and moist, well-drained soil, this hosta is easy to grow, tolerant of a range of conditions, and moderately resistant to deer when mature. Its mounding habit and bold foliage also make it a beautiful choice for containers and shaded pathways.

Plant Details & Features:
-
Plant Type: Hardy perennial
-
Foliage Color: Golden-yellow centers with green to chartreuse margins
-
Flower Color: Pale lavender
-
Bloom Time: Mid to late summer
-
Height & Spread: 20–24 inches tall, 36–48 inches wide
-
Light Requirements: Partial to full shade
-
Soil Needs: Moist, well-drained, fertile soil
-
Water Needs: Moderate; prefers consistent moisture
-
Maintenance: Low; remove faded flowers and tidy foliage as needed
-
Wildlife Friendly: Attracts hummingbirds and pollinators; moderately deer-resistant
-
Special Features: Bold foliage color, large leaves, excellent for shade, great in containers or as a specimen plant
